I got mine from RPM outlet for $80. It worked just fine for me as long as you follow the directions. It wasn't too bad removing the pulley, but would have been easier if I had one other person helping. It probably took me 30 minutes total, to take the old one off and put the new one on.

I would highly recommend using a tool, I've heard of people trying to get by without it and costing them alot more in the end.
